Brake Release Cam
Genuine Whirlpool part
By: Whirlpool
Part Number: WP8546461

This brake release cam works with the washer's brake assembly to disengage the brake during spin and re-engage it at stop. Replacing a worn cam restores smooth basket spin and reduces squeal or grinding at spin transitions.

  • Disengages the brake so the basket can spin; helps reapply the brake as the cycle ends
  • Supports smooth starts and stops of the spin cycle
  • Worn or damaged cams can cause no spin or intermittent spin
  • Common symptoms include loud squeal/grinding at start/stop or a burning odor near the brake area
What's included: 1 brake release cam Install notes:
  • Disconnect power (and water supply, if moving the washer) before service
  • Access the brake/basket drive area; the brake spring is under tension—use caution and eye protection
  • Note orientation of parts before removal; seat the new cam correctly
  • After reassembly, run an empty spin test to verify operation

Do-It-Yourself Stories from Customers like You No spin every thing else worked made high speed ticking noise   Anthony D. • Follansbee , WV • May 12, 2015

First I looked at the many you tube vids, and there are many. appliance parts pros pretty much shows you how to deal with the parts. I changed the brake shoes and the clutch assembly which also comes with the driver cam. I also changed the metal brake operating cam. I think that brake lockup or improper brake release was the problem that broke the plastic cam driver. This was the broken plastic part making all the ticking noise. Clutch Spring Cap (Washer)
Genuine Whirlpool part
By: Whirlpool
Part Number: WP62646

This clutch spring cap retains and protects the clutch spring in your washer's drive/clutch assembly, maintaining proper tension. Replacing a worn or missing cap helps the clutch engage smoothly and reduces slipping and noise during spin.

  • Secures the clutch spring within the clutch assembly to prevent movement or dislodging
  • Maintains correct spring preload for consistent clutch engagement
  • Can help reduce clutch slip that appears as weak/no spin, slow spin ramp-up, or intermittent spinning
  • Common signs of trouble: rattling or scraping near the drive, burning smell, or a visibly damaged/missing cap
What's included: 1 clutch spring cap Install notes:
  • Unplug the appliance and shut off water before servicing
  • Access the clutch per your model's service procedure; removing the gearcase/transmission and clutch may be required
  • Carefully relieve spring tension and note the orientation of the spring and cap before removal
  • Inspect the spring, clutch lining, and related hardware; replace any worn components during reassembly
